Covering Blackpool, Burnley, Bradford & Leeds Areas
£44,863 (£20.30ph) Basic Salary + Paid Door-to-Door Travel
42.5 Hours per Week
1 in 8 Call-Out Rota
Company Van (Personal Use Permitted), Fuel Card, Tools & Phone Provided
Overtime Paid at 1.5x and 2x Rates
A leading national provider of Automatic Entrance Systems is looking to recruit an experienced Automatic Door Engineer.
